| | | Pink grassland flower for ID? Please can someone tell me what this lovely little flower is called - the depth of colour is somewhat faded now I have uploaded, the pink was a fair bit richer than shown.
This plants was common in a patch of grassland I visited, and its ID will no doubt be obvious to someone. But I have others shots if needed.

| | | Re: Pink grassland flower for ID? Looks to me like Red Bartsia Odonites verna, in the Figwort family. Its an annual hemiparasite of grasses. The spike is one-sided.
